Project Description

Tulip Oil Netherlands B.V. is the operator of the Donkerbroek-West en Donkerbroek-Main gas field. To extend the gas reserves in this field Tulip Oil decided to drill a new development/appraisal well (DKK-04). Project planning, tendering, engineering, coördination, management, and supervision was carried out by WEP, whereas other companies provided the materials and services.

The well has been spudded on the 2nd of July and WEP & Tulip Oil Netherlands BV have released the DrillTec VDD200.1 rig on the 24th of July. DKK-04 was successfully drilled within budget and presence of gas has been proved. The well was drilled directionally to a total depth of 2665 m AH. Total operational days from spud to rig release was 23 days. Well Engineering Partners provided the overall engineering, total project management and well site supervision for this project.
